getPendingChanges method

  1. @override
Future<List<T>> getPendingChanges()
override

Implementation

@override
Future<List<T>> getPendingChanges() async {
  // In a real Drift implementation, this would be:
  // return await _database.getPendingModels();

  // For now, we'll simulate returning pending changes
  print('DriftAdapter: Getting pending changes from $tableName');

  // Simulate database query
  await Future.delayed(Duration(milliseconds: 10));

  // Return empty list for now - in real implementation, this would query the database
  return <T>[];
}